Transaction e34ac6d0ded26a67718b028d97960972221384cedb45b40a93fc33231582aa87
1 Input
1 Output
-
e34ac6d0ded26a67718b028d97960972221384cedb45b40a93fc33231582aa87:0
- value
- 659798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dd8dacb1e7b8233d420333a0f8213b776c1c8b5 OP_EQUAL
- address
- 3QqEfQKcwMGHgTHPu8BtZJVrM2y4ejgwQ8